    How Bathroom Count Affects Water Demand Patterns

    The three bathrooms in your spacious home might be a point of pride, but they're also an essential factor in determining your water softening needs.

    first image
    Your home's multiple bathrooms aren't just luxury features—they're critical factors in calculating your water treatment requirements.

    When multiple bathrooms operate simultaneously—perhaps during your family's morning rush—your water system experiences significant demand spikes.

    We've observed that homes with 1-2 bathrooms typically manage well with 30,000-45,000 grain capacity softeners. However, your three-bathroom layout creates a different usage pattern altogether, requiring at least 60,000 grain capacity to maintain steady performance.

    During peak usage times, an undersized system simply can't keep up, allowing hard water to bypass treatment. This compromises water quality precisely when you need it most.

    Calculating Peak Water Usage in Multi-Bathroom Homes

    Understanding your home's peak water demand goes beyond simply counting bathrooms—it requires a precise calculation of what happens when everyone needs water simultaneously.

    Those morning rushes when showers run while the dishwasher cycles and someone starts laundry create the true test for your water softener.

    For a family of four, you'll need a system handling over 260 gallons daily, but it's those concentrated usage spikes that matter most.

    With 3+ bathrooms, we recommend at least a 60,000-grain capacity system to prevent hard water breakthrough during peak times.

    When sizing your softener, consider this scenario: three showers running concurrently while appliances operate.

    Undersized systems simply can't keep up, leaving you with spotty glasses and scale buildup despite your investment.

    Water Flow Rates: The Critical Factor for Larger Households

    Four critical aspects of water flow rate determine whether your softener will perform adequately in larger households.

    First, simultaneous use of multiple fixtures dramatically increases demand—when showers, faucets, and toilets run concurrently, your system needs capacity to handle it all.

    Multiple fixtures running at once creates demand spikes your water softener must handle to maintain performance.

    Second, peak usage times matter; a family of four can easily consume 300+ gallons during morning routines, requiring systems rated for 11+ GPM.

    Third, undersized softeners create a domino effect: insufficient flow leads to pressure drops and hard water bypass, compromising your entire system's performance.

    Finally, bathroom count directly correlates with necessary flow capacity—more bathrooms mean you'll need systems handling 10-16 GPM to maintain consistent water quality and pressure.

    We've found that properly sized softeners guarantee both adequate pressure and softening during high-demand periods.

    Beyond Bathrooms: Additional Sizing Considerations for Optimal Performance

    While bathroom count provides a solid foundation for sizing decisions, it represents only one piece of the water softener sizing puzzle.

    We've found that truly ideal sizing requires looking beyond fixtures to your home's unique water usage patterns.

    Consider these critical factors when making your selection:

    1. Household occupancy - Each person typically uses 65-80 gallons daily, directly impacting your system's workload and regeneration needs.
    2. Water hardness levels - Higher measurements above 10 gpg demand considerably larger grain capacities for effective treatment.
    3. Future growth considerations - Anticipate potential household expansion or additional water-consuming appliances to avoid premature system replacement.
